**Key Ceremony Checklist — Item 4 (Support Team)**

Context: the Pixelhollow image cache leak (tickets from the Marrowfield deploy) forced an emergency key rotation after the cache node crashed mid-signing. Before the new keys go live: confirm the patched cache build is running, heap stays flat for 30 minutes, and evictions fire correctly. Do not tell customers keys changed until rotation completes. To unseal the standby signing card during the ceremony, enter the phrase printed below.

strongbox words: norwyn-wenael-aldvan-aldiel-wendor-holael

## Step 4: Resolve the sync conflict

Heads up, reviewer: Meridly's calendar sync now prefers the remote copy when both sides changed within the merge window. This flips the old local-wins behavior, so double-check the conflict tests. After applying the migration, the resolver should be running with the following settings.

settings of fafog-haduf:
ZORIX_PIN=4648
ZORIX_METRICS_HOST=metrics.zorix.paliqsys.corp
ZORIX_LOG_LEVEL=info
ZORIX_TENANT=druix

Ticket: SDK parity vault locked. The shared test-credentials vault for the Orlique Java and Swift SDK parity work has locked after a token expiry. You'll need it to run the cross-SDK conformance suite before closing parity gaps. Nothing else is blocked. To unlock the vault, enter the recovery passphrase below.

unlock words, hafop-tahog: drumir-druiel-kasox-wenax-tamys-frair

## Service account: parcelhook-runner

The parcelhook-runner account delivers tracking webhooks from Cartonflux to downstream consumers. It retries failed deliveries five times with exponential backoff, then parks events in the dead-letter queue. On-call: if deliveries stall, check the queue depth first; restarting the worker rarely helps. The account authenticates to the internal Cartonflux dispatch API on every delivery. Rotate quarterly. The current key for the dispatch API follows on the next line.

gateway credential: kto23_LX9A4ys6i4nzHtpOLNLodKK